Convection-driven hydrogen recombination chimney within nuclear power plant containment

This novel unit (1') recombines hydrogen in a gas mixture, especially when plant operation ceases for any reason. It includes a catalyst assembly (2) in a casing (4) allowing through flow under natural convection. The catalyst is preceded by a flame trap (8). Preferably, the flame trap (8) and an interceptor (14) precede the catalyst. The interceptor is integrated into the flame trap and cooled by the flow of gas mixture into the casing (4). Above the top outlet opening (28) from the casing, there is a drip roof (30). The flame trap has openings for the inlet gas flow, their mean diameter greater than 0.1 mm. Each is 0.2-3 mm in mean diameter. The catalyst assembly and flame trap border a maximum flame length of 0.3 m.
